My only serious problem was a complete system lock-up due to a Realtek
RTL-8185 PCI WiFi card. Bus error and a kernel panic (divide error, fatal
exception in interrupt, etc.) whenever the card was used. This started on
20.04 with a recent kernel update which resulted in the OS being trashed
after multiple occurrences. So I started over with a new 22.04 install
(which had the same problem). I had to switch to a USB WiFi dongle. I
probably should file a bug report about it.
Wildly inexplicable errors are often due to hardware problems. Check RAM
and drive SMART status.
Also try to narrow down the problem with a test of 21.04 and 22.10 or a
different variant (Kubuntu, etc.)
